A predetermined electrode arrangement (1 / 1, 1 / 2. 1 / 3A, 1 / 6) comprising a plurality of shielded electrodes (213, 215) and a plurality of shielding electrodes (204, 214, 269A, 269B,) that together with other conductive (799, 206, 208, 207, 203, 218, 216, 217, 218) semi-conductive (not shown) and / or non-conductive material elements (212) are formed into a multi-functional energy condition assembly (1-1, 1-2, 1-3A, 1-6) or variant to be selectively coupled into circuitry (4-1, 5-1, 1-2).

field of invention [0001] The new electrode arrangement involves an energy conditioning assembly, an electrode circuit arrangement, and a divided electrode arrangement structure. More specifically, the new electrode arrangement relates to multifunctional electrode arrangements and shielding elements for modulating the fraction of energy propagating along energized conductive paths or energized circuitry. Background of the invention [0002] Electrical systems have experienced short product life cycles in the last decade. A system built just two years ago is considered to be behind the third or fourth generation of the same application. Therefore, passive components and circuits installed in these systems also need to be developed as quickly as possible. However, the development of passive components has not kept up.
